Multiplex relative quantitation of peptides and proteins using amine-reactive metal element chelated tags coupled with mass spectrometry

Abstract

Here we describe a chemical labeling method for multiplex relative quantitation of peptides and proteins by coupling metal element chelated tags (MECT) to peptides followed by mass spectrometric analysis.
